Brick Hardscape Construction in Norwalk, CT
Brick hardscape construction services encompass the design and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ing features made from brick materials. Common projects include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and garden borders.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ance outdoor living spaces, improve property functionality, or add visual appeal to their landscape. Before requesting brick hardscape work,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the area, drainage requirements, and the style or pattern of brickwork they prefer, ensuring the final result complements the overall property design.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scape construction involves knowing the types of bricks available, the foundation requirements for different structures, and the expected lifespan of the installations. Property owners typically want clarity on the durability of materials, the maintenance involved, and how the project will integrate with existing landscaping. Asking questions about the process, material options, and overall project planning can help ensure the completed hardscape meets both aesthetic and functional expectations.

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scape construction? Brick hardscapes are ideal for patios, walkways, garden borders, and retaining walls to enhance outdoor spaces.
What are the benefits of choosing brick for hardscape features? Brick provides durability, a classic appearance, and low maintenance for various outdoor structures.
Can brick hardscape features be customized to match existing property styles? Yes, brick options come in different colors, patterns, and sizes to complement different property designs.
What should property owners consider before installing a brick hardscape? Consider the intended use, site conditions, and overall aesthetic to ensure the brick features meet the property's needs.
